Product Details

Description

The Bently Nevada 330500-00-20 Velocity Sensor Velomitor, manufactured in the USA by Bently Nevada, is a compact and reliable device designed for accurate vibration and velocity monitoring in industrial machinery.

Specifications

  • Manufacturer: Bently Nevada

  • Country of Origin: USA

  • Model Number: 330500-00-20

  • Series: Velocity Sensor Velomitor

  • Type: Seismic vibration and velocity sensor

  • Measurement Range: Configurable for machinery vibration monitoring

  • Output Signal: 4-20 mA proportional to velocity level

  • Frequency Response: Wide range suitable for industrial applications

  • Mounting: Compact housing for easy installation

  • Cable Type: Shielded for noise immunity

  • Case Material: Stainless steel for durability

  • Operating Environment: Designed for harsh industrial conditions

Features

  • High Accuracy: Provides precise velocity and vibration measurement for critical machinery

  • Durable Construction: Stainless steel housing ensures long-term reliability

  • Easy Integration: Compatible with Bently Nevada monitoring systems

  • Compact Design: Simplifies installation in limited spaces

  • Stable Output: 4-20 mA signal ensures continuous monitoring

  • Noise Immunity: Shielded cable reduces interference

  • Industrial Grade Materials: Built for rugged environments and extended service life

Transforming Shop Floor Data into Actionable Insights: A Deep Dive into MES

Transforming Shop Floor Data into Actionable Insights: A Deep Dive into MES

Manufacturing Execution Systems serve as the digital backbone of modern factory floors. Positioned at Level 3 of the ISA-95 automation pyramid, MES links enterprise resource planning with real-time shop floor control systems. Today, industrial operators rely on MES software to bridge operational strategy with physical production execution.
